Перейти к содержимому


Фотография
- - - - -

вопрос по экспорту


Лучший Ответ SmetDenis , 11 December 2015 - 13:48

STEP_SIZE   внутри файла нужен только для категорий. Там пока нет шагающего экспорта. Лучше не трогать.

 

jeyhunm сказал(а) 11 Дек 2015 - 12:13:

в начало установили значение 100 , отгрузил где то 1/3 часть  товаров потом установили значение 1000, отгрузил побольше,

Это количество материалов, которые буду обрабатываться за один запрос (шаг)  браузера.

Когда прогресс дойдет до 100%, то в выгрузке должны быть все выбранные материалы. Их кол-во не зависит от шага.

 

Если сервер не может за один запрос выгрузить 1000, то лучше уменьшить нагрузку на него и поставить меньше, например 100.

Перейти к сообщению


  • Закрытая тема Тема закрыта
Сообщений в теме: 21

#11 jeyhunm

jeyhunm

Отправлено 28 November 2015 - 09:26

теперь выдал в конце вот такое, что это ?

 

Screenshot_2.png


  • 0

#12 isay777

isay777

Отправлено 28 November 2015 - 14:40

SmetDenis сказал(а) 25 Сен 2015 - 11:10:

Сейчас экспорт работает за один шаг, поэтому не сможет выгрузить за раз большое количество информации.
Пока единственный вариант - это выгружать каталог по частям.

Проблема сложнее чем кажется, получится исправить только с отдельным компонентом JBZoo.
 
Возможно вы включили режим отладки либо постоянный режим компиляции less.

 

 

Денис объясни а почему раньше таких проблем с экспортом не было (имею ввиду 220). А после какой-то версии стали постоянные проблемы. Как быть, если я не могу ждать до третей версии и переносить на третью версию вообще не собираюсь? 

 

У меня конечно есть архивы старых версий 220... Мне новые проекты на них делать? Я как-то не очень понимаю.... 

 

Мпорт/экспорт - это основа сайта, я постоянно выгружаю и загружаю товары на сайт я без экспорта не могу... ну никак. 


  • 0
ХОСТИНГ для сайтов jbzoo (все попугаи)

#13 SmetDenis

SmetDenis

Отправлено 28 November 2015 - 22:47

isay777 сказал(а) 28 Ноя 2015 - 13:40:

Денис объясни а почему раньше таких проблем с экспортом не было (имею ввиду 220). А после какой-то версии стали постоянные проблемы. Как быть, если я не могу ждать до третей версии и переносить на третью версию вообще не собираюсь?


Я честно говоря не знаю, почему раньше таких проблем не было. Нужно изучать вопрос.
Знаю что, масса ошибок на 154 строке относится к сборке и разборке массивов данных для csv (когда несколько значений в одной ячейке). Через функцию проходит очень много данных, и последние 3 года она работала без капризов.

У меня закончилась головная боль с распродажей, тарифами, демо-сайтами, новостями и прочей жестью.... которую мы готовили к blackfriday Со следующей недели собираюсь приступить к публикации решений для импорта (которые были оплачены ранее добрыми людьми) и так же хочу сделать пошаговый экспорт и еще пару важных фич для 220.

Надеюсь это решит эти вопросы.
  • 3
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.


#14 isay777

isay777

Отправлено 28 November 2015 - 22:52

SmetDenis сказал(а) 28 Ноя 2015 - 21:47:

Я честно говоря не знаю, почему раньше таких проблем не было. Нужно изучать вопрос.
Знаю что, масса ошибок на 154 строке относится к сборке и разборке массивов данных для csv (когда несколько значений в одной ячейке). Через функцию проходит очень много данных, и последние 3 года она работала без капризов.

У меня закончилась головная боль с распродажей, тарифами, демо-сайтами, новостями и прочей жестью.... которую мы готовили к blackfriday Со следующей недели собираюсь приступить к публикации решений для импорта (которые были оплачены ранее добрыми людьми) и так же хочу сделать пошаговый экспорт и еще пару важных фич для 220.

Надеюсь это решит эти вопросы.

 

 

Очень надеямся. 


  • 0
ХОСТИНГ для сайтов jbzoo (все попугаи)

#15 programmos

programmos

Отправлено 29 November 2015 - 03:56

SmetDenis сказал(а) 28 Ноя 2015 - 21:47:

Я честно говоря не знаю, почему раньше таких проблем не было. Нужно изучать вопрос.
Знаю что, масса ошибок на 154 строке относится к сборке и разборке массивов данных для csv (когда несколько значений в одной ячейке). Через функцию проходит очень много данных, и последние 3 года она работала без капризов.

У меня закончилась головная боль с распродажей, тарифами, демо-сайтами, новостями и прочей жестью.... которую мы готовили к blackfriday Со следующей недели собираюсь приступить к публикации решений для импорта (которые были оплачены ранее добрыми людьми) и так же хочу сделать пошаговый экспорт и еще пару важных фич для 220.

Надеюсь это решит эти вопросы.

Прям очень ждем!


  • 0

#16 jeyhunm

jeyhunm

Отправлено 29 November 2015 - 10:18

получается, что не один я такой счастливчик :) ,

подождем!


  • 0

#17 isay777

isay777

Отправлено 08 December 2015 - 00:16

Опять возникла проблема. 

Ситуация плачевная, у меня по всем категориям раскидано 2500 товаров не активных (выкл). 

Мне нужно их удалить. Раньше бы я просто выгрузил все активные и загрузил обратно по id с опцией удалить, все что не нашлись. 

 

А как мне это сделать выгружая категориями? Ибо целиком никак... У меня тогда... В общем засада. Ручками удалять 2500 товаров.... жесть


  • 0
ХОСТИНГ для сайтов jbzoo (все попугаи)

#18 SmetDenis

SmetDenis

Отправлено 09 December 2015 - 11:23

isay777 сказал(а) 07 Дек 2015 - 23:16:

Ручками удалять 2500 товаров.... жесть

Не обязательно удалять через панель управления. Можно удалять через phpMyAdmin по признаку state=0|1

Экспорт я почти дописал, отлаживаю.
  • 1
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.


#19 jeyhunm

jeyhunm

Отправлено 11 December 2015 - 13:13

после последнего обновления JBZoo: 2.2.4 Pro rev3047 возник вопрос.

в настройках появилось возможность указать шаг экспорта.

в начало установили значение 100 , отгрузил где то 1/3 часть  товаров

потом установили значение 1000, отгрузил побольше,

как нам удостовериться, что отгрузились все товары ?

или я не понимаю, что означают эти шаги ?

 

 

кстати в файле export.php

/media/zoo/applications/jbuniversal/framework/helpers/export.php

 значение  const STEP_SIZE   = 500;  оставляем как есть ??


  • 0

#20 SmetDenis

SmetDenis

Отправлено 11 December 2015 - 13:48   Лучший Ответ

STEP_SIZE   внутри файла нужен только для категорий. Там пока нет шагающего экспорта. Лучше не трогать.

 

jeyhunm сказал(а) 11 Дек 2015 - 12:13:

в начало установили значение 100 , отгрузил где то 1/3 часть  товаров потом установили значение 1000, отгрузил побольше,

Это количество материалов, которые буду обрабатываться за один запрос (шаг)  браузера.

Когда прогресс дойдет до 100%, то в выгрузке должны быть все выбранные материалы. Их кол-во не зависит от шага.

 

Если сервер не может за один запрос выгрузить 1000, то лучше уменьшить нагрузку на него и поставить меньше, например 100.


  • 0
JBZoo v4.0 и новый чудный мир Open Source GPL
Отключайте проверку лицензий как можно скорее!



— Есть два типа людей: Кто еще не делает бекапы и кто уже делает бекапы.





Click to return to top of page in style!